The Infinite Horizon of Inner Struggles

In 'Horizonte Infinito' by Utopia, the lyrics delve into the profound sense of disillusionment and introspection. The song opens with the narrator lamenting the loss of an 'infinite horizon,' a metaphor for boundless possibilities and dreams. This horizon, once filled with promise, now feels distant and unattainable. The narrator's inability to believe in what they deeply desire reflects a crisis of faith and self-doubt. The mirror imagery symbolizes self-confrontation, where the narrator faces their own pretenses and lies, highlighting a struggle with authenticity and self-acceptance.

The repeated desire to hear 'frases malditas' and 'palavras nunca ditas a ninguém' (cursed phrases and words never spoken to anyone) suggests a yearning for raw, unfiltered truth. This craving for honesty, no matter how harsh, underscores the narrator's desperation to break free from the illusions and falsehoods that have clouded their reality. The dreamlike state mentioned in the lyrics represents an escape into a world of 'false truths,' a place where the narrator can temporarily avoid the harshness of their actual circumstances. However, this escape is fleeting, and they inevitably return to a state of confusion and solitude.

The song's cyclical nature, where the narrator repeatedly finds themselves alone and in the dark, emphasizes the persistent nature of their inner turmoil. The 'dark corner of the street' and the 'dark side of the world' are metaphors for the isolation and despair that accompany their journey. Utopia's 'Horizonte Infinito' is a poignant exploration of the human condition, capturing the essence of existential angst and the relentless pursuit of self-understanding amidst a backdrop of disillusionment and solitude.
